My Buying Guides on Router Bit For T Track

What I Look for in a Router Bit for T Track

When I shop for a router bit for T track, I first make sure the bit matches the exact profile of the track I plan to use. I have learned that even a small mismatch can cause a loose fit or make the track impossible to install properly. I also pay close attention to the bit’s diameter, cutting depth, and overall design so I can get a clean, accurate groove.

My First Priority: Compatibility with the T Track

For me, compatibility matters more than anything else. I always check the manufacturer’s specifications for the T track and compare them with the router bit dimensions. If the bit is too wide or too narrow, the track will not sit correctly. I prefer to measure both the track and the bit before making a purchase, because that saves me from costly mistakes.

Material and Build Quality I Trust

I usually go for router bits made from carbide because they stay sharp longer and handle repeated use better than cheaper alternatives. In my experience, a solid steel body with carbide cutting edges gives me the best balance of durability and performance. I also inspect the shank quality, since a strong shank helps reduce vibration and improves control.

Cutting Performance I Expect

I want a bit that cuts smoothly without burning the wood or leaving rough edges. A sharp, well-balanced router bit helps me achieve cleaner grooves and reduces the amount of sanding or cleanup afterward. I also prefer bits with good chip clearance because they keep the cut cooler and more efficient.

Shank Size I Prefer

I always check whether the bit comes with a 1/4-inch or 1/2-inch shank. Personally, I prefer a 1/2-inch shank whenever my router supports it, because it feels more stable and less likely to flex during deeper cuts. For lighter jobs, a 1/4-inch shank can work, but I find the larger shank gives me better confidence.

Depth and Adjustability Matter to Me

When I install T track, I need precise control over the groove depth. I look for bits that let me cut to the exact depth required by the track. If the depth is off, the track may sit too high or too low, which can affect how accessories fit and function.

My Preference for Clean, Accurate Results

I like router bits that leave a crisp edge and a flat-bottomed groove. That makes the T track seat properly and gives the project a professional look. I have found that taking time to make test cuts on scrap material helps me confirm the fit before I cut into the final piece.

Safety Features I Never Ignore

I always make safety a priority. I use a router bit only if it is in good condition, properly installed, and rated for my router’s speed. I also wear eye protection and keep a firm grip on the tool. If a bit looks worn, chipped, or unbalanced, I replace it right away.

My Buying Tips Before I Decide

Before I buy, I compare reviews, check the bit’s dimensions, and confirm that it works with my router and the T track I own. I also look for a product from a brand I trust, especially if I plan to use it often. A slightly more expensive bit is usually worth it to me if it gives cleaner cuts and lasts longer.
